Saint-Jean-Baptiste Day (French: Fête de la Saint-Jean-Baptiste, la Saint-Jean, Fête nationale du Québec), also known in English as St John the Baptist Day, is a holiday celebrated on June 24 in the Canadian province of Quebec and by French Canadians across Canada . The processional procession begins with the images of St. John the Baptist, St. Mary Magdalene and the Christ of the Mirrors leaving the … NettetLocated at Campagne, in the Dordogne department, the Saint-Jean-Baptiste church is a religious building of the 12th century. Listed in the Historical Monuments, it hosted at the time in his choir the bodies of the lords of Campagne. Romanesque style, it originally depended on an Augustinian priory before becoming a parish church in the late ...

VEGETABLES. ciner resources green river wyNettetJohn the Baptist. John the Baptist (late 1st century BC – 28–36 AD) was an itinerant Jewish preacher in the early 1st century AD. John the Baptist is revered as a religious figure in Christianity, Islam, the Bahá’í Faith, and Mandaeism.
